‘tis now been quite a while since I imbibed the fragrance that haunts my memory in dreams and I have no means to rekindle the incense of sacred vibhuti that osmotically filled my being and so without seeking I yet yearn to invoke that ineffable elixir sublime and if this be desire, I have sinned
